Anisotropic Optical Shock Waves in Isotropic Media with Giant Nonlocal Nonlinearity

Anisotropic Optical Shock Waves in Isotropic Media with Giant Nonlocal Nonlinearity

Dispersive shock waves in thermal optical media are nonlinear phenomena whose intrinsic irreversibility is described by time asymmetric quantum mechanics.
